Evidence-Based Virtual Care
Online therapy can be an effective treatment option for many concerns, including anxiety, depression, trauma-related symptoms, grief, relationship stress, ADHD, and life transitions. The quality of the therapeutic relationship, treatment approach, client engagement, privacy, and clinical fit remain important whether counseling takes place online or in person.
Virtual care is not the best format for every person or every situation. A therapist may recommend in-person care, a higher level of support, medical evaluation, or another specialized service when those options better match the client’s needs.

Transform & Renew uses a secure telehealth platform designed for healthcare services. Clients should also choose a private location, use a secure internet connection, and limit interruptions whenever possible.
Virtual counseling can be effective for many mental health concerns when it is clinically appropriate. Treatment format is only one factor; therapist fit, evidence-based care, participation, privacy, and consistency also influence outcomes.
Many insurance plans cover virtual behavioral health services, but coverage, copays, deductibles, and therapist participation vary. Our administrative team can help verify benefits whenever possible before your first appointment.
Some children can benefit from virtual counseling, while others may respond better to in-person treatment. The decision depends on age, developmental needs, attention, presenting concerns, caregiver involvement, safety, and therapist recommendations.
You will need a smartphone, tablet, laptop, or desktop computer with a camera, microphone, reliable internet connection, and access to a private location where you can speak comfortably.
Yes. Couples may attend from the same private location or, when approved by the therapist, from separate locations. Both partners must be physically located in Texas during the appointment.
